Laure Devers is a scholar working on Epidemiology, Hematology and Biochemistry. According to data from OpenAlex, Laure Devers has authored 6 papers receiving a total of 517 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Epidemiology, 3 papers in Hematology and 2 papers in Biochemistry. Recurrent topics in Laure Devers's work include Hematopoietic Stem Cell Transplantation (3 papers), Blood groups and transfusion (2 papers) and Liver Disease Diagnosis and Treatment (2 papers). Laure Devers is often cited by papers focused on Hematopoietic Stem Cell Transplantation (3 papers), Blood groups and transfusion (2 papers) and Liver Disease Diagnosis and Treatment (2 papers). Laure Devers collaborates with scholars based in France. Laure Devers's co-authors include C Boccaccio, G. Andreu, Claudine Leberre, Yat Long Lam, R. Tardivel, Françoise Imbert‐Bismut, Djamila Messous, A Piton, Anne Mercadier and Thierry Poynard and has published in prestigious journals such as Blood, Journal of Medical Virology and Clinical Chemistry and Laboratory Medicine (CCLM).
